Skip to content

Commit a4f2768

Browse files
committed
Install sherlock directory as a module
Was previously polluting the site-packages directory with top-level python files
1 parent 0ecb496 commit a4f2768

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

pyproject.toml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 requires = ["setuptools >= 61.0"]
33
build-backend = "setuptools.build_meta"
44

55
[project.scripts]
6-
sherlock = "sherlock:main"
6+
sherlock = "sherlock.sherlock:main"
77

88
[project.urls]
99
Homepage = "http://sherlock-project.github.io/"
@@ -39,10 +39,10 @@ classifiers = [
3939

4040
[tool.setuptools.dynamic]
4141
dependencies = { file = [ "requirements.txt" ] }
42-
version = { attr = "sherlock.__version__" }
42+
version = { attr = "sherlock.sherlock.__version__" }
4343

4444
[tool.setuptools]
45-
package-dir = {"" = "sherlock"}
45+
packages = [ "sherlock" ]
4646

4747
[tool.setuptools.package-data]
4848
"*" = ["*.json"]

0 commit comments

Comments
 (0)